Transaction 1551570a5d7696c337e09113b4faf7b060bdb878284a2b0049ac277659064b2d

1 Input
2 Outputs
  • 1551570a5d7696c337e09113b4faf7b060bdb878284a2b0049ac277659064b2d:0
  • value  5359000
    address  33z6MXfmtwvsJusJmyY8K1VTb6wbcRFU8R
  • 1551570a5d7696c337e09113b4faf7b060bdb878284a2b0049ac277659064b2d:1
  • value  23622123
    address  1AJcaxVgn3mLjFDYyUGioNxsxjgdYMGZqQ